I am checking on the Ford Service Info right now...

It seems:
- Trans. Specifications was revised in 2024
- Clutch B section was revised in 2023
- Main control valve body was revised in 2021
... procedure for the rest date 2018-2019 (unchanged)

Unfortunately impossible to know what.
